Swiss Alpine Ski Team look forward to new season

Sunday, October 12 2014 by SNTV
  • Intro:

    Members of the Swiss winter sports team look ahead to the new season in Zurich, Switzerland on Saturday (11th October).

    Script:

    SOUNDBITE (English) Dominique Gisin, Olympic downhill champion:

    "I feel of course inspired. The moment to stand on the podium in front of the crowd in front of the Olympic fire, well... being locked in my heart forever and it will always give me a lot of emotions and a lot of energy. And there's of course a part of me that knows that there will never be another moment as emotional as in Sochi, but I will keep that with me it will for sure motivate me to do more races like that and push really hard."

    SOUNDBITE (English) Sandro Viletta, Olympic combined champion:

    "Yeah for sure, the World Championships in Vail... My goal is to be on the start on the Super combined and Super-G maybe if I have a good season I am going for downhill. But these two disciplines are on my focus."

    SOUNDBITE (English) Lara Gut, Olympic downhill bronze medallist 2014:
    (concerning Lindsey Vonn)

    "Well I think it's always good for us skiers to be back on skis and I hope for her that her knee is fine. That is I think the most important thing."

    SOUNDBITE (English) Carlo Janka, former world and Olympic Giant Slalom champion:

    "Everything is possible now I have new material new skies this season so I have to look how everything works. When everything works well I think everything is possible."
